E11EVEN Miami is bringing a ‘pop-off’ residency to Toronto for the World Cup

20 April 20262 Mins Read

Miami is coming to Toronto this summer. E11EVEN Miami is bringing its top-notch nightlife experience to the city with its official E11EVEN Toronto Pop-Off Series for the World Cup.

From June 13 to July 4, the E11EVEN Toronto Pop-Off Series will bring a nightlife residency to FYE Nightclub. It will be centred on key match days and major weekends. After all, the World Cup will be the city’s biggest sporting event in years.

What to expect

This will be the place to be if you want more than just a watch party. This is a full celebration. And if you know E11EVEN Miami, you’re in for a good time.

The pop-up is part of the brand’s multi-city “Where the World Comes to Play” initiative, which will also bring the residency to New York.

As for Toronto’s residency, expect live performances, themed entertainment, and special guest appearances on June 13, June 20, June 27 and July 4. More dates will be announced.

This is an experience you don’t want to miss out on.

Tickets are available now and can be purchased online. Pre-sale tickets start at $53.26.

When: June 13, June 20, June 27 and July 4, 2026
Where: FYE Ultraclub – 15 Saskatchewan Rd.
Cost: $53+
